The B4U band was riding high on the success and their tour was planned to be nothing short of perfect. But when do plans ever sail so smoothly?

Aurora Eugene had been struggling to confess her feelings to Davian. After putting it off for months, when she finally mustered up the courage, things took an unexpected turn.

Meanwhile, Jaxon and Declan were enjoying life in the fast lane until they crossed paths with Tiana and Ariel and their carefree lifestyle took a one-eighty-degree turn. They were forced to confront their pasts and question their futures, all the while trying to navigate their newfound feelings.

As the tour continued, the band found themselves on a rollercoaster of wild emotions and twists. Would they be able to come out stronger, or would it leave irreparable cracks in their hearts?
